This role involves:
Delivering a wide range of high-quality Civils and Drainage products to customers in Colchester and the surrounding areas. In this role, you will be expected to
Ensure efficient & safe operation of the vehicle
Strive to complete on time delivery of orders to JDP customers
Comply with all vehicle and drivers' legislation
Providing customers with product and service information
Pick customer orders accurately
Assist with loading and unloading of vehicles using a forklift truck
Process orders accurately, within a time dictated by the customer deadline
Serve customers on the trade counter when required
Customer interaction
Qualifications
Essential:
Class C Licence
Some Driver CPC training
Digital driving licence (tacho card)
An understanding of Health & Safety in a work environment
Detailed understanding of driver procedures "driving hours rules & regulations"
Experience in efficient route planning
Excellent communication and customer service
Required:
Excellent customer service skills
Literacy & Numeracy
Desirable:
Warehouse/yard experience
A good knowledge of computers
Forklift truck licence
